Transaction 7ac8080d82076fdb172cdf1247e4a09b0bf4bd37aedb5641c8f28aebf3f58498

2 Input
2 Outputs
  • 7ac8080d82076fdb172cdf1247e4a09b0bf4bd37aedb5641c8f28aebf3f58498:0
  • value  85527
    address  39kC58SrRxzyZv51pxgMEitqcioUkwmLKS
  • 7ac8080d82076fdb172cdf1247e4a09b0bf4bd37aedb5641c8f28aebf3f58498:1
  • value  108500
    address  3HaHKqNKJzFiFfWTC3mXkaJ4woUD5TbSNY